P0704 Code: Fix Clutch Switch Input Circuit Intermittent with ICARZONE UR1000 Diagnostic Tool
P0704: Clutch Switch Input Circuit Intermittent
Solve P0704 in Ford, Chevrolet, and Volkswagen models. Learn causes, symptoms, and fixes using the ICARZONE UR1000 diagnostic tool.
Get ICARZONE UR1000 Now1. What is P0704?
P0704 is a generic OBD-II Diagnostic Trouble Code (DTC) defined as Clutch Switch Input Circuit Intermittent (for manual transmissions) or Transmission Control System Intermittent (for automatic transmissions). The code triggers when the Engine Control Module (ECM) or Transmission Control Module (TCM) detects erratic, intermittent, or lost electrical signals from the clutch position switch (manual) or transmission control circuit (automatic).
The clutch switch (manual) sends a critical signal to the TCM/ECM when the clutch is depressed, enabling smooth gear shifts, preventing stalling, and controlling torque management. For automatic transmissions, P0704 points to intermittent communication between the TCM, speed/pressure sensors, and ECM. This intermittent fault disrupts transmission operation, leading to shifting issues, reduced performance, and potential transmission damage if left unaddressed.
Impact on Transmission Operation
In Ford, Chevrolet, and Volkswagen vehicles—both manual and automatic—P0704 causes the TCM to default to a "safe mode" (limp mode) to protect transmission components. Manual transmissions may experience difficulty shifting or stalling during gear changes, while automatic models suffer from delayed/hard shifts, erratic gear engagement, or loss of specific gears. Turbocharged models (EcoBoost, TSI) are especially affected, as the TCM relies on clutch/transmission signals to manage boost pressure during shifts.
2. Common Causes in Ford, Chevrolet & Volkswagen
P0704 stems from intermittent electrical faults in the clutch/transmission control circuit. Real-world diagnostic cases from ICARZONE technicians include:
- Faulty Clutch Switch (Ford F-150 Manual 5.0L) – UR1000 live data showed intermittent open/closed signals from the clutch switch; replacing OEM switch #BL3Z-7A543-A restored consistent communication with the TCM.
- Worn/Corroded Wiring Harness (Chevrolet Silverado 6.6L Duramax Automatic) – Rodent damage to TCM wiring caused intermittent voltage drops; heat-shielded wiring repair + dielectric grease fixed signal loss.
- Loose Connector (Volkswagen Jetta GLI 2.0T Manual) – Vibration from performance driving loosened the clutch switch connector; crimping pins + replacing the locking tab eliminated P0704.
- TCM Internal Malfunction (Ford Transit 3.2L Power Stroke Automatic) – Intermittent electrical failure in the TCM caused false P0704 triggers; UR1000’s TCM test identified the fault before unnecessary switch replacement.
- Failed Transmission Speed Sensor (Chevrolet Colorado 2.8L Duramax) – Erratic speed sensor data caused TCM communication issues; UR1000’s sensor accuracy test pinpointed the faulty sensor (not the clutch switch).
- Battery Voltage Fluctuations (Volkswagen Tiguan 2.0T Automatic) – Weak battery (12.1V vs. 12.6V spec) disrupted TCM power supply; charging the battery + cleaning ground connections cleared P0704.
3. Key Symptoms of P0704
P0704 presents intermittent symptoms that worsen with vibration, temperature changes, or extended driving—key signs to watch for:
- Check Engine Light illuminated (often paired with P0700 "TCM Malfunction" or P0715 "Input Speed Sensor" codes)
- Manual Transmissions: Difficulty shifting gears, stalling when pressing the clutch, or no start in gear (safety feature activation)
- Automatic Transmissions: Delayed/hard gear shifts, erratic shifting between gears, or loss of overdrive
- Intermittent "limp mode" (TCM limits RPM/power to protect transmission)
- Reduced acceleration and throttle response (especially during gear changes)
- UR1000 live data showing "Clutch Switch: Intermittent" or "TCM Signal: Fluctuating"
- Hard starting (manual) or no crank (automatic) – TCM prevents engine start due to incorrect clutch/transmission signals
4. Models Prone to P0704
These models have a higher incidence of P0704 due to clutch switch design, TCM calibration, or wiring placement:
- Ford: 2015-2023 F-150 (5.0L Manual/3.5L EcoBoost Automatic), 2017-2022 Transit (3.2L Power Stroke Automatic), 2019-2023 Ranger (2.3L EcoBoost Manual)
- Chevrolet: 2016-2023 Silverado 2500HD/3500HD (6.6L Duramax Automatic), 2015-2023 Colorado (2.8L Duramax Manual/Automatic), 2020-2023 Tahoe (5.3L Automatic)
- Volkswagen: 2017-2023 Jetta GLI (2.0T Manual), 2018-2023 Golf GTI/R (2.0T Manual), 2019-2023 Tiguan (2.0T Automatic)
Relevant TSBs: Ford 22-1345 (TCM software update), GM 23-NA-198 (clutch switch wiring repair), VW 22V105 (TCM calibration for automatic transmissions).
5. Diagnostic Steps with ICARZONE UR1000
Use the ICARZONE UR1000 to accurately diagnose P0704 and avoid unnecessary clutch switch/TCM replacement (a common mistake with basic scanners):
| Step | Action with UR1000 | Goal | Pass/Fail Criteria |
|---|---|---|---|
| 1 | Full System Scan > "Transmission Control Module" | Verify P0704 and check for related codes (P0700, P0715, P0720) | Pass: Isolated P0704 | Fail: Multiple TCM/sensor codes (indicates larger transmission issue) |
| 2 | Live Data > "Clutch Switch Status/TCM Signals" | Monitor real-time clutch switch (manual) or TCM sensor data (automatic) during driving | Pass: Consistent open/closed signals (manual) or stable sensor data (automatic) | Fail: Random signal drops/spikes |
| 3 | Circuit Test > "Clutch Switch/TCM Voltage" | Measure supply voltage (12V) and signal voltage (0-5V) to the clutch switch/TCM | Pass: Voltage 11.8-12.6V (supply) / 0-5V (signal) | Fail: Voltage <11.5V (power issue) or erratic signal |
| 4 | Active Test > "Clutch Switch/TCM Command Test" | Send bi-directional commands to test clutch switch response (manual) or TCM operation (automatic) | Pass: Switch/TCM responds to commands | Fail: No response or intermittent activation |
| 5 | TCM Software Check > "Calibration Version" | Verify TCM has latest P0704-related firmware updates | Pass: Latest calibration installed | Fail: Outdated version (requires reflash to fix false P0704) |
Case Example: 2022 Chevrolet Silverado 6.6L Duramax Automatic with P0704 – UR1000 live data showed TCM signal drops at 40mph. Circuit test revealed 11.2V supply voltage (low) – cleaning corroded battery terminals restored voltage to 12.5V, clearing P0704 without replacing any parts (saving $180 in labor/parts).
Diagnose P0704 with UR10006. Fixes & Execution for P0704
Repair strategies depend on UR1000 diagnostic results—target the root cause instead of replacing parts blindly:
- Clutch Switch Replacement (Manual) – Install OEM switch (Ford #BL3Z-7A543-A, GM #19300427, VW #1J0927189). Adjust switch position to 0.5-1mm clearance from clutch pedal and perform TCM relearn via UR1000.
- Wiring Harness Repair – Replace damaged wires with 18-gauge automotive wire (higher gauge for TCM circuits). Use heat-shrink tubing and wire loom to protect against engine bay heat/vibration.
- Connector Service – Disconnect battery, clean pins with electrical contact cleaner, apply dielectric grease to prevent corrosion, and replace broken locking tabs (common in VW manual transmissions).
- Sensor Replacement (Automatic) – Replace faulty transmission speed/pressure sensors (Ford #DL3Z-7M101-A, GM #24204029, VW #09G927321) and perform sensor calibration via UR1000.
- TCM Reprogramming – Use UR1000 to install the latest TCM firmware (critical for 2018+ Ford 10R80/GM 10L80 automatic transmissions with P0704 software bugs).
Model-Specific Tips
- Ford EcoBoost (Manual): After clutch switch replacement, run "Clutch Pedal Position Relearn" via UR1000 (requires 10 clutch depressions + 5-mile test drive).
- Chevrolet Duramax (Automatic): Inspect TCM wiring near the transmission pan—fluid leaks can corrode pins; replace the gasket and clean pins with dielectric grease.
- VW TSI (Manual): Adjust clutch switch clearance to 0.8mm (critical for preventing P0704 recurrence) – use a feeler gauge and UR1000 to verify signal consistency.
7. Repair Costs & Safety Tips
Critical Safety Precautions
- Disconnect the negative battery terminal before working on clutch/TCM wiring to prevent electrical shorts and TCM damage.
- Use a jack stand to secure the vehicle if accessing the transmission pan/sensors (automatic) – never rely on just a jack.
- Adjust clutch switch clearance precisely (manual) – too much/too little clearance causes recurring P0704 and shifting issues.
- After repairs, clear codes with UR1000 and test drive under various conditions (city/highway, acceleration/deceleration) to confirm P0704 does not return.
- Avoid heavy towing/hauling until P0704 is fixed – "limp mode" reduces transmission cooling, increasing risk of overheating/damage.
8. Preventive Maintenance
Avoid recurring P0704 with these proactive maintenance steps (recommended by ICARZONE technicians):
- Inspect clutch switch/wiring (manual) or TCM sensors/wiring (automatic) every 30,000 miles – look for corrosion, frayed wires, or loose connectors.
- Apply dielectric grease to clutch switch/TCM connectors during every oil change to prevent water/corrosion damage (critical in wet climates).
- Use UR1000 to monitor TCM/clutch switch signals quarterly – catch abnormal readings before P0704 triggers.
- Replace transmission fluid at OEM-recommended intervals (every 60,000 miles for automatics) – old fluid causes TCM sensor errors and P0704.
- Keep battery/charging system in good condition (12.6V at rest) – low voltage is a top cause of intermittent TCM signals and P0704.
- Update TCM firmware via UR1000’s free lifetime updates – manufacturers release fixes for P0704 logic errors in new models.
9. Frequently Asked Questions
Short distances (under 80 miles) are possible, but long-term driving risks transmission damage (especially in automatics), reduced fuel economy, and unsafe shifting. Diagnose P0704 promptly with UR1000 to avoid costly repairs.
Only if the issue is a misaligned switch (common in manual transmissions). Use UR1000 to verify signal consistency after adjustment – if signals are still intermittent, replace the switch or check wiring.
OEM switches are recommended. Aftermarket switches often have inconsistent signal output, leading to recurring P0704 in Ford/GM/VW TCMs (calibrated for OEM specs).
UR1000 captures intermittent TCM/clutch switch signals (missed by basic scanners), tests circuit voltage, verifies TCM calibration, and performs sensor/clutch switch relearn – avoiding guesswork and unnecessary parts replacement.
Yes – cold temperatures contract wiring/connectors, worsening loose/corroded connections and causing P0704 to trigger more frequently. UR1000’s live data helps identify temperature-related signal issues.
Typically 80,000–120,000 miles. Frequent clutch use (performance driving) or harsh weather can reduce lifespan to 50,000 miles in manual transmissions.
10. Summary
P0704 indicates an intermittent clutch switch input circuit fault (manual) or transmission control system fault (automatic), caused by faulty clutch switches, worn wiring, corroded connectors, sensor failures, or outdated TCM software. Common in Ford, Chevrolet, and Volkswagen vehicles—both manual and automatic—this code leads to shifting issues, reduced performance, and potential transmission damage. The ICARZONE UR1000 is critical for accurate diagnosis: it captures intermittent signals, tests circuit voltage, verifies TCM calibration, and guides targeted repairs (switch replacement, wiring repair, or TCM reflash). Preventive maintenance (regular inspections, fluid changes, battery care) and UR1000’s quarterly monitoring help avoid recurring P0704 issues and extend transmission lifespan.
Fix P0704 with UR1000
The ICARZONE UR1000 provides real-time TCM/clutch switch monitoring, circuit testing, and TCM updates to accurately diagnose and repair P0704 in Ford, Chevrolet, and Volkswagen vehicles—saving you time and money on unnecessary parts and repairs.
Buy UR1000 Now